🏝️ Geographic and Cultural Differences
Geographically, Okinawa is an island chain located in the southernmost part of Japan. Its unique location and history have shaped the island's culture and approach to wellness. In contrast, Japan is a vast and diverse country with a wide range of landscapes and cultures. The differences in geography and culture between Okinawa and Japan have resulted in distinct approaches to wellness tourism. Okinawan cuisine, for example, is known for its emphasis on fresh seafood and unique ingredients, while Japanese cuisine is famous for its sushi and ramen. Visitors to Okinawa can experience the island's unique beaches and snorkeling spots, while Japan offers a wide range of hiking and skiing destinations.

🍜 Unique Aspects of Okinawan Wellness
One of the unique aspects of Okinawan wellness is its emphasis on Blue Zone living. The island is one of the five Blue Zones in the world, where people live longer and healthier than anywhere else. Visitors to Okinawa can experience the island's unique approach to longevity and wellness, which is reflected in its diet, lifestyle, and community.
